PRIMARY PURPOSE:

Provides clerical services, instructional support and assists with the daily operation of the campus.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

Education and Certification Requirements High school graduate or GED equivalent Candidate must have satisfactory outcome of fingerprinting background check Special Knowledge and Skills

Proficiency in typing, word processing, and file maintenance skills Effective organizational, communication, and interpersonal skills Ability to follow written and oral instructions Basic math skills Ability to work well and in a positive manner with students, employees and the public Knowledge of general office equipment Pleasant voice on telephone, personable attitude and appearance to public Ability to remain calm in a stressful situation, and defuse confrontational situations Demonstrates a mature, responsible attitude necessary for the position Ability to operate a multi-line phone system Ability to meet established deadlines Knowledge of basic accounting principals Experience:

Minimum one (1) year clerical, secretarial, and/or data entry experience in an office setting MAJOR RESPONSIBILITIES AND DUTIES
